Standard Premium Finance Holdings Announces $250,000 Stock Repurchase Program

MIAMI, May 27,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Standard Premium Finance Holdings, Inc. (OTCQX: SPFX), a leading specialty finance company, today announced that its board of directors approved a stock repurchase program where the Company may purchase up to $250,000 of common stock in privately negotiated transactions over a six-month period, expiring November 2, 2025. Over 1,000 Sites Found Mining Cryptocurrency Illegally in Kuwait

KUWAIT CITY, April 22: The Ministry of Interior has issued a warning against unlicensed cryptocurrency mining activities in Kuwait, cautioning that such operations are in violation of national laws.
